‘Yeete Nsem’ will not divert my attention from my real songs – Amerado

Lamy Gates by Lamy Gates
August 19, 2020
Reading Time: 2 mins read
ShareTweetShare

Versatile artiste Amerado has said ‘Yeete Nsem’ will not take his attention from entertaining fans with more songs.

‘Yeete Nsem’ is Amerado’s way of informing fans of trendy issues. He compiles all the topics that trended in a week which he delivers in rap format.

From all indications, this style of entertaining fans has come to stay but he noted that he will not be carried away.

He said this in an exclusive interview with Kwame Dadzie on Ghanaweekend TV.

When Kwame asked Amerado how soon he is dropping a new song aside from the weekly ‘YeeteNsem’, he replied, “I think on the 28th or 29th I’m dropping my new song with a video.”

“YeeteNsem is a strategy to get people’s attention to my craft and if that’s what you like, I know when I drop songs you’ll watch and refer me to your friends to listen as well.”

He noted that ‘YeeteNsem’ keeps his fans entertained until he releases a new song and that it does not divert him from doing real songs.

Meanwhile, Amerado also disclosed that people give him stories to add to the ‘YeeteNsem’.
